Q: How many clients can associate to an Access Point?
A: An Access Point is a shared medium and acts as a wireless hub. The performance of each user decreases as the number of users increases on an individual AP. Ideally, not more than 24 clients should associate with the AP because the throughput of the AP is reduced with each client.

Q: What are possible sources of interference for the radio frequency (RF) link?
A: Interference can come from a number of sources, such as 2.4 GHz cordless phones, improperly shielded microwave ovens and wireless equipment from other manufacturers.

Q: What is a POE?
A: PoE (Power-over-Ethernet) eliminates the need to run 110/220 VAC power to wireless Access Points / Client Bridges and other devices on a wired LAN. Using PoE, system installers can run a single CAT5 Ethernet cable that carries both power and data to each device. This allows greater flexibility in locating the AP's and network devices and significantly decreases installation costs in many cases. PoE begins with a CAT5 "Injector" that inserts a DC Voltage onto the CAT5 cable. The Injector is typically installed in the "wiring closet" near the Ethernet switch or hub.
